Apple & Granola Yogurt Bowl
Sweet, tender cinnamon apples, creamy yogurt, and crunchy granola come together for a delicious balance of sweet, tangy, and crunchy.
A delicious autumn breakfast to warm you up!

Ingredients:
- 1 apple, cored, peeled and chopped
- 1 teaspoon butter or coconut oil
- 1 teaspoon cinnamon
- 1 tablespoon maple syrup
- 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
- 2-4 tablespoons water
- 150g (Greek) yoghurt (normal or plant-based)
- 1 bag Vegan Granola Date & Almond (40g)
Preparation:
Add the apple pieces, butter or coconut oil, cinnamon, maple syrup and vanilla to a saucepan. Cook over medium heat for about 8 minutes, stirring regularly and adding a little water if the apples get too dry.
Serve the roasted cinnamon apples over the yogurt and garnish with the crunchy granola.
Benefits of this recipe:
Rich in fiber
The apples and granola in this recipe provide a good dose of fiber. Fiber is essential for healthy digestion and can help keep you feeling fuller for longer, which can help you avoid unhealthy snacking.
Proteins for long-lasting energy
The yoghurt provides a portion of protein. Protein is essential for muscle repair and building and helps keep your energy levels stable throughout the day.
Antioxidants thanks to cinnamon
Cinnamon is not only a delicious spice, but it is also packed with antioxidants. These antioxidants can help fight inflammation and improve overall health.
